Updated SEC baseball standings with one regular-season game remaining

The 2025 baseball regular season will come to an end Saturday for all 16 Southeastern Conference teams. The SEC Tournament will be contested with a single-elimination format May 20-25 at Hoover Metropolitan Stadium in Hoover, Alabama.

No. 14 Tennessee (41-14, 16-13) and No. 5 Arkansas (42-12, 19-10 SEC) are tied, 1-1, in a three-game series at Baum–Walker Stadium in Fayetteville, Arkansas. Rankings reflect the USA TODAY Sports Coaches Poll.

Tennessee won the series opener, 10-7, while the Razorbacks won game No. 2, 8-6.

The series finale between the Vols and Razorbacks is slated for 3 p.m. EDT on Saturday and will be televised by SEC Network.

Other scores from SEC play on Friday: Oklahoma 8, Texas 6; Alabama 9, Florida 6; Ole Miss 15, Auburn 11; Vanderbilt 9, Kentucky 8; LSU 8, South Carolina 1; Texas A&M 6, Georgia 0 and Mississippi State 13, Missouri 3.

Below are updated SEC regular season standings with one game remaining.

2025 SEC baseball standings entering final day of regular season

TeamSEC recordTexas21-8Arkansas19-10LSU18-11Vanderbilt18-11Georgia17-12Alabama16-13Auburn16-13Ole Miss16-13Tennessee16-13Florida14-15Oklahoma14-15Mississippi State14-15Kentucky13-16Texas A&M11-18South Carolina6-23Missouri3-26
